    I upgraded mine to part number 84652-02710 because that drove me nuts too. It is really a plug and play upgrade, but I paid about $120 for mine. I bet someone that knows who sells them here will show up soon.

    This is the best upgrade I made to my Tacoma, with the backup camera and cruise control being close behind.

    I bought the intermittent wiper switch for my 2014 regular cab, and am on my second Entune upgrade. I went from base to HD to HD with navigation. It is an easy swap. Make sure you also get the navigation antenna. It fits under the dash. If you want Sirius / XM, then you need the shark fin antenna, or a non-factory antenna you can mount inside the truck.

    Easy upgrade. I bought my switch from TRDParts4U.com. They even gave me a call when they saw the VIN that I entered did not indicate a truck with intermittent wipers, to make sure that I was doing an upgrade and not purchasing the wrong item. Easy to install. Lots of threads here and YouTube videos to show you how. Took me longer to find the screwdriver than it did to do the install.
